Abstract
It is shown that the same essentially non-semiclassical mechanism, which generates in the nonsupersymmetric pure Yang-Mills theory the binary condensate of gauge field strengths, is responsible for the spontaneous breaking of the two supersymmetries in N=2 super Yang-Mills systems.
